Product: HP Web JetAdmin
Operating System: Microsoft Windows Server 2008 (64-bit)
When viewing all devices in Jet admin the column Device firmare and Jetdirect Revision says <Not supported> for some printers (example HP Laserjet 400 M401dn). but does reflect that a Device firmware is available for upgrade. So we upgrade the printer, does indeed upgrade fine to the new firmware but HP jetadmin does not reflect the update and always says an update is needed. The Device firmware Column still says <Not supported>. This does occure for all HP laserjet 400 series printers. Can someone tell me why this happens, is this a bug, what am i missing? Thanks Scott
